Before I bought this I did a lot of research, I have recently bought a full frame Nikon D750 having used crop frame DSLR's for some years. I am a landscape photographer and therefore sharpness through the photo is really important to me. I read lots of reviews and especially those that did direct comparison tests between this and the more expensive Nikon eqivelent lens. The Tokina performed very well in all these side by side tests. Factors To Consider: 1. This is a heavy lens (946g) 2. Due to the construction of the front element it will not take conventional filters 3. It's a BIG lens If you are a serious photographer then this lens is well worth considering for FULL FRAME Sensors, if you are using a crop frame sensor then this lens is not really for you.
